Sydney, Australia, September 21, 2011 -- Ala Paredes, Daniella Serret, FELINO DOLLOSO, Jemwel Danao, Kim Shazell, Shy Magsalin and Valerie Berry will headline Aussies of the Magic Mic and Adobo Kind, a series of candid vignettes portraying the many layers of being Filipino Australian, which premieres at the 2011 Sydney Fringe Festival on September 29, 30 and October 1.

First-time playwrights Rosary Coloma and Erica Enriquez have whipped up the play's concept from their amusing and poignant observations of life as an Australian of Filipino heritage.

"It's a show that anyone, of any background, can relate to.  It's the story of multicultural Australia -- finally told from a Filipino's point of view," Coloma said.

Aussies of the Magic Mic and Adobo Kind will play at the Cultural Centre at the Italian Forum, Leichhardt, 23 Norton Street, Leichhardt  2040.  For more information, call 0449 153 650.  Tickets start from $18 for children, $20 for concession/pensioners and $25 full price.
